Why Use External Links in Shopify Blog Posts?

External links serve several important purposes in ecommerce content. They can provide credibility by linking to authoritative sources, improve user experience by pointing to detailed information, and support SEO by showing search engines the relevance and context of your content. For Shopify merchants, external links can complement product education articles, buying guides, and FAQ content by offering trusted references or detailed tutorials hosted elsewhere.

However, external links must be used carefully to avoid sending visitors away prematurely. The key is to balance external references with strong internal linking to your products, collections, and other blog posts. This approach encourages readers to explore your store further while still benefiting from the additional context external links provide.

Best Practices for External Linking in Shopify Blogs

Start by planning your blog draft with clear SEO goals. Use keyword research to identify long-tail search terms relevant to your products and customer questions. Incorporate these keywords naturally in your SEO titles, meta descriptions, and URL slugs. Structure your content with H2 and H3 headings to make it easy to scan and understand.

When adding external links, make sure they open in a new tab to keep visitors on your site. Limit the number of external links to avoid overwhelming readers or diluting your SEO value. Always pair external links with internal links to related products, collections, or other blog posts. This not only improves navigation but also helps search engines understand the relationship between your pages.

Optimizing Images and Media Around External Links

Images, videos, and other media can enhance your Shopify blog posts and support your linking strategy. Use featured images with descriptive alt text that includes relevant keywords to improve SEO. Optimize image sizes to ensure fast loading times, which is critical for retaining visitors. When linking externally, consider adding relevant images or videos near those links to provide context and keep readers engaged.

Embedding videos or tutorials related to your external references can also reduce bounce rates by offering valuable content without forcing visitors to leave your store. Properly optimized media combined with thoughtful linking creates a richer, more engaging user experience that benefits both SEO and conversions.

Comparison of Linking Strategies in Shopify Blogs

Linking Strategy Benefits Risks Best Use Case
Internal Links Only Retains visitors, improves site structure, boosts SEO May limit content depth or external credibility Product education, collection pages, related blog posts
External Links Only Provides authoritative references, enriches content Can lose visitors, dilute SEO value Referencing industry data, tutorials, or certifications
Balanced Internal & External Links Combines credibility with visitor retention Requires careful management to avoid overload Buying guides, FAQ articles, long-tail SEO posts
